Question - Company X has net sales revenue of $1,250,000, cost of goods sold of $760,000, and all other expenses of $290,000. The beginning balance of shareholders' equity is $400,000 and the beginning balance of fixed assets is $361,000. The ending balance of shareholders' equity is $600,000 and the ending balance of fixed assets is $389,000. What is the Return On Equity of the company?
